The simplest way to add motion to your spread is by picking a decoy that moves easily in light winds. Full strut decoys tend to catch more wind and spin readily, as do lightweight decoys. WebJun 9, 2024 · This time of year is when birds are most vulnerable—and the most defensive. The consequences of getting too close to a nest can be severe. Birds can abandon nests if disturbed or harassed, dooming eggs and hatchlings. Less obvious, repeated human visits close to a nest or nesting area can leave a path or scent trail for predators to follow.

I would classify the “late season” as the last 10 to 14 days of … kansas state university football 2020WebApr 6, 2016 · The hen decoy which is in breeding position, along with a jake, can really bring in a tom like he’s on a string. As the season continues, mix things up. For example, when hens are laying eggs or nesting, they are often seen alone.
